ELATHEA CRAMER, 1777

Pap[ilio] Dan[aus] Cand[idus] elathea Cramer, 1777: 5 , 148, pl.99, figs C, D [original plate 67, figs B, B]. ‘J’ai reçu celui-ci de la Virginie’ [I have received this from Virginia] [error – Haiti? or Jamaica?].

Papilio View in CoL Danaus View in CoL Candidus elathea, Stoll, 1782b: 6 [No. 82].

Material examined. No potential Cramer specimens located.

Current status. Valid species in Eurema ( Lamas, 2004b) .

EPAPHIA CRAMER, 1779

( FIG. 32 View Figures 27–32 )

Pap[ilio] Dan[aus] Cand[idus] epaphia Cramer, 1779: 26 , 174, pl.207, figs D, E [original plate 176, figs C, C]. Sierra Leone.

Papilio View in CoL Danaus View in CoL Candidus epaphia, Stoll, 1782b: 5 [No. 51].

Material examined. Syntype ♀, with van Lennep label ‘ No. 51 EPAPHIA Cr. III. 207. D. E. ’ (‘ orbona Boisd’ added in pencil) ( BMNH (E)#665128) is a good match with original plate 176, figs C, C; thorax damaged with some evidence of a second pinhole .

Current status. Valid species in Appias (Glutophrissa) ( Ackery et al., 1995) .
